Summary
Former Cleveland Browns quarterback Johnny Manziel responded to an Ohio radio host’s comments about a viral clip of him talking about his time with the team. Manziel, who was a first-round pick in 2014 and had a tumultuous two-season stint with the Browns, expressed his continued animosity towards the team and its fans. He also took aim at current quarterback Deshaun Watson, referencing his legal troubles and struggles on the field. Manziel’s response was explicit and defensive, highlighting his lingering frustration with the team and its supporters.
